The Master Musketeer 1 is ideal for making 2 cups of coffee (6-8oz) or filling 6-12oz cups with its 600ml capacity.
Pros:
- Perfect for beginner and intermediate coffee makers and cafes using basic patterns.
- The long, narrow spout makes it easy to create basic patterns. The well-balanced 240g weight aids in pouring and producing straight cuts. It's durable with a thickness of 0.8mm.
- The handle is laser-welded in two spots to avoid heat marks.

Important Notes on Black and Green Teflon-Coated Jugs:
- Non-Stick Benefit: Teflon offers a smooth, fast milk flow but wears down over time.
- Care Tips:
- To prolong the jug's life, steam your milk in a different pitcher and transfer it to the Teflon jug for pouring.
- Avoid steaming milk directly in the Teflon jug to prevent scratches and damage.
- Be cautious with sharp or coarse tools like steam wands, thermometers, or clips as they can scratch the coating.

MUSKETEER 1
- Slight variations in stainless steel milk jugs are normal due to the production process. We ensure these differences stay within an industry-standard tolerance of 1-2mm.
- To maintain consistency, we use the Paper Metric Scale method. We place the jug upside down, align the spout's tip to the midpoint of the scale, and adjust the rim until it matches the same number on both sides. This precise method ensures accurate alignment beyond visual inspection.
- During manufacturing, we carefully align each jug. While small variations of 1-2mm can occur due to material properties, we rigorously inspect every jug before packaging and shipping.
